Jerry Stenger is the Media Development Director for the Will Steger Foundation and videographer for Global Warming 101 Expeditions. First joining Will in 1989 when he was preparing for his International Trans-Antarctica Expedition, Jerry continues to produce, shoot and edit video programming for Steger’s projects. His involvement with each of Will’s successive expeditions has taken him to places such as Siberia, the North Pole, Antarctica and northern Canada.

The Polar Times features an article on the village of Igloolik, on Baffin Island. Igloolik is home to Artcirq, a performance theatre group who uses the art form to tell the story of Inuit life.
The community of about 700 people has been a destination point on several of Steger's expeditions. The article includes images from the Will Steger Foundation's 2007 Baffin island Expedition, taken by team member, Abby Fenton.

Polar explorer, environmental advocate and educator Will Steger will be a featured speaker at the Education Minnesota Professional Conference Oct. 21. Steger, a Minnesota native, will talk about his 45 years of experience in wilderness exploration and education, as well as the use of online education to focus attention on environmental issues.

The Race to the South Pole.
Almost one hundred years ago, two teams of explorers set off on dueling quests to be the first to reach the South Pole. One team returned victorious without losing a single man, while the other team perished. We'll take a look at a new museum exhibition that looks at the histories of explorers Roald Amundsen and Robert Falcon Scott.
Featured guest is Will Steger Foundation's Baffin Island Expedition basecamp manager, John Huston.

Where Politics and Science Should Not Mix.
WSF Summer Institute keynote speaker, Naomi Oreskes was the featured guest on Minnesota Public Radios Mid Morning program with Kerri Miller.
Oreskes, a science historian explains why some scientists are trying to undermine recent research on global warming and spread mistruths. She is Professor of History and Science Studies at the University of California San Diego. Her latest book is called "Merchants of Doubt: How a Handful of Scientists Obscured the Truth on Issues from Tobacco Smoke to Global Warming."
